Expert Reviews

Silver & 94 Pts - Halliday Rating.

Medium-bodied in a beautiful way. Clove, peppercorn, plum and black cherry flavours sweep through the palate in satiny style. There's barely a kink nor a ruffle. It has a clear savoury, gently meaty edge and it's all the better for it. Price is better than reasonable. - Campbell Mattinson, 1 August 2020.

Winery Tasting Notes

Colour: Deep red colour.

Bouquet: A classic cool-climate Shiraz nose which shows plum fruit, spice and black pepper characters. There is some subtle complexity and quality French oak characters of char and cedar.

Palate: A rich and generous front palate fills the mouth with plum fruits. There is a thread of black pepper running the length of the palate, reminding us of its cool climate origins. The wine has great poise and balance thanks to balanced acidity and firm yet ripe tannins. This also provides power and drive, yet, wonderful restraint. The high quality French oak adds cedary characters and blends really well with the cool climate spice notes. The wine has great length and the flavours linger in the mouth long after the wine has gone.

FOOD ACCOMPANIMENT

An ideal complement to red meats and hearty dishes. Will also go well with ripe cheeses at the end of a meal.

CELLARING POTENTIAL

Will continue to improve and develop complexity with age; cellar for 8 to 10 years.

Winery Profile

Rob Diletti is a quiet achiever who crafts very fine wines for Castle Rock Estate and other products. The hallmark of his style is a light touch and purity of fruit, resulting in wines that taste effortless and genuine. - Huon Hooke

The wines from Castle Rock Estate were made under contract at Alkoomi winery from 1986 to 2000. The next phase of growth was to make our wines on site at Castle Rock Estate. After the 2000 vintage we decided to bite the bullet and proceed with plans to build a 200 tonne winery on the estate. Despite having nearly twelve months, it was only just completed on time, the first tanks arriving only four days before the first grapes arrived.

Planned by Robert and Angelo the winery building makes use of the natural slope of the land and is built on two levels. The grapes are crushed and fermented on the upper level, then gravity fed into the press below, thus doing away with the need to pump the must. This is very important for Riesling as it reduces skin and seeds which give the juice hard phenolics.

The upper level houses four six tonne red fermenters. When the reds have finished fermenting, the press can be positioned below and filled simply by opening the door! The winery is a blend of age old, proven techniques and some equipment which is state of the art. The press, de-stemmer/crusher and refrigeration system were bought brand new so we are sure of their ability performance and reliability. The use of gravity ensure we are not over reliant on machines and we believe we have the right balance to maximise quality.

The wine is bottled on site by a portable bottling line which is set up on the back of a semi-trailer. This is an ideal arrangement as we aren't sending the wine away in a bulk tanker and we don't need to outlay huge capital for a bottling line. Bottling on site means we can be sure that the quality and freshness of the wine is maintained.
